All our animals are sold as follow with full pedigrees:
Show Quality: means there are no faults that we know of or disqualifications or genetic defects and the animal can be shown
Brood Quality: means no genetic defects, disqualifications, and these animals can be very good for breeding
Pet Quality: means the animal is healthy but just does not have the type for showing or breeding, or has disqualifications or defects
